Abstract
BACKGROUND The efficiency of a commercial immunochromatography kit (IP-NoV) was evaluated for rapid detection of norovirus in Japanese fecal specimens and its sensitivity and specificity were compared with two other commercial kits. METHODS A total of 70 samples collected from children who suffered from acute gastroenteritis in 2009 - 2010 were tested for norovirus by three different immunochromatography kits. RT-PCR was employed as the gold standard method. RESULTS The sensitivity of IP-NoV, QuickEx-Norovirus, and QuickNavi-Norovirus kits were 85.2%, 63.9%, and 55.7%, respectively. The IP-NoV kit could detect various genotypes of norovirus with higher efficiency as compared to QuickEx-Norovirus and QuickNavi-Norovirus kits. In addition, the phylogenetic analysis revealed that the majority of noroviruses circulating in Japan during 2009 - 2010 belonged to GII/4 variant 2006b and 2008a, which were responsible for the outbreaks worldwide. CONCLUSIONS The findings indicated that the IC kits could be used as an alternative method for direct detection of norovirus in clinical specimens covering a wide range of norovirus genotypes circulating in Japan.

Abstract
We describe an 8-year-old girl with the mildest form of acute necrotizing encephalopathy, associated with pandemic influenza A. She manifested a convulsion engendering deterioration of consciousness, although cranial computed tomography and magnetic resonance imaging within 4 hours after the convulsion revealed no abnormalities. Cranial magnetic resonance imaging 20 hours after the convulsion revealed lesions of the thalamus bilaterally, brainstem tegmentum, internal capsule, and white matter. She was diagnosed with acute necrotizing encephalopathy. Typically, the prognosis of acute necrotizing encephalopathy with a brainstem lesion is poor. Nevertheless, she recovered almost completely, after early intervention with pulsed methylprednisolone and high-dose γ-globulin therapy. She manifested a thermolabile phenotype of carnitine palmitoyltransferase II variants such as cystine-isoleucine-methionine phenotype type 9 (FVM-CIM; Phe352Cys-Val388Ile-Met647Met alleles), resulting in a predisposition to encephalopathy during influenza infection. This case is the first, to the best of our knowledge, of pandemic influenza A-associated acute necrotizing encephalopathy with a good outcome despite severe magnetic resonance imaging findings.

Abstract
A patient with a large deletion of the distal part of the long arm of chromosome 13 showed severe psychomotor retardation, a characteristic face, nystagmus, retinopathy, cystic kidney disease, and brain malformation with molar tooth sign and cerebellar vermis hypoplasia, a phenotype typical of Arima syndrome. This patient also had bilateral retinoblastoma. Fluorescent in situ hybridization and single-nucleotide-polymorphism genotyping microarray demonstrated an interstitial deletion of 54 Mbp, ranging from 13q14.13 to 13q32.3 and involving the RB1 gene. This patient is the first case of Arima syndrome, or a Joubert syndrome-related disorder, that showed linkage to chromosome 13q.

Abstract
Acute necrotizing encephalopathy is a syndrome of acute encephalopathy characterized by bilateral thalamic lesions and prevalent among children in East Asia. The antecedent infection is usually a viral disease with high fever, such as influenza and exanthem subitum. There are neurologic symptoms, such as coma, convulsion and brainstem dysfunction, and findings of systemic organ involvement. Despite the efficacy of corticosteroids in some cases, the prognosis is often poor with a high mortality and severe neurologic sequelae. Recent studies have elucidated the genetic background, providing a clue to the pathogenesis.

Abstract
Norovirus (NoV) is a causative agent of gastroenteritis in children and adults worldwide. Although reverse transcription-polymerase chain reaction (RT-PCR) has been accepted as the standard method for diagnosis of NoV infection, it requires well-trained personnel and sophisticated equipments. Performance of a commercial immunochromatography (IC) test for rapid detection of NoV was evaluated with fecal specimens collected from children admitted to a hospital with acute gastroenteritis during 2005-2007 in Chiang Mai, Thailand. A total of 463 fecal specimens were tested for the presence of NoV by a commercial immunochromatography kit (IP-NoV) and by RT-PCR. Sensitivity, specificity, and agreement of immunochromatography as compared to RT-PCR were 74.2%, 99.5%, and 96.1%, respectively. Based on the NoV genotypes determined by phylogenetic analysis, immunochromatography detected NoV GII/3, GII/4, GII/6, GII/13, GII/15, and GII/16 genotypes. The findings indicate that the immunochromatography kit could be used for a direct detection of NoV GII in clinical specimens and covering a wide range of NoV genotypes circulating in Thailand.

Abstract
BACKGROUND Noroviruses are a major cause of epidemic gastroenteritis in children and adults. The aim of the present study was to investigate the molecular epidemiology of norovirus gastroenteritis in Japan. METHODS A total of 954 fecal specimens collected from infants and children with acute gastroenteritis from five different regions (Tokyo, Sapporo, Saga, Osaka, and Maizuru) of Japan during 2007-2009 were identified by multiple RT-PCR and semi-nested PCR. RESULTS Norovirus was detected in a relatively high detection rate (26.6%; 254 of 954). Of the identified NoV, 9.5% (91 of 954) were positive by semi-nested PCR. Norovirus GII (97.3%) was more prevalent than GI (2.7%). Norovirus infections were very common in the patients aged 12-23 months (44.5%; 113 of 254). Winter month seasonality supported norovirus infection in Japan. All 7 GI sequences (100%) detected only in 2007-2008 clustered with Chiba 407 known as GI.4 genotype. Most of the norovirus GII sequences in 2007-2008 belonged to GII.4 (77.9%), followed by GII.14 (11.9%), and GII.3 and GII.6 (5.1% each). In 2008-2009, norovirus sequences were classified into eight distinct genotypes (GII.1, GII.2, GII.3, GII.4, GII.6, GII.7, GII12, and GII.14). GII.4/2006b variant was responsible for 100% among the detected GII.4 strains in both seasons. Interestingly, GII.6/GII.14 recombinant strains emerged, for the first time in Japanese children, as the second prevalent genotype (11.9%) in 2007-2008 and then dropped rapidly to 2.3% in a year after. In addition, GII.b/GII.3 and GII.4/GII.3 recombinant strains that had been described previously were also found in this study. CONCLUSIONS This is the first report to demonstrate the co-circulation of the predominant GII.4/2006b variant and the emerging GII.6/GII.14 recombinant strains and supports the importance of norovirus as a causative agent of diarrhea in Japanese children with acute gastroenteritis.

Abstract
In Japan, a revised act on organ transplantation is enforced from July 2010. This act enables an infant or a child with brain death to become a donor for organ transplantation under the consent of his or her family members. New diagnostic criteria have been set for children under six years of age. Diagnosis of brain death in infancy and childhood requires special caution, since an infant's brain has special features. The causes of brain death also vary according to the age. The new criteria exclude from candidates of donor neonates and infants under 12 weeks of corrected age, as well as cases in which the possibility of child abuse cannot be completely denied. The time interval between two diagnostic procedures must be 24 hours or more.

Abstract
A novel reverse transcription-multiplex polymerase chain reaction assay was developed to detect Aichi virus, human parechovirus, enteroviruses, and human bocavirus. A mixture of four pairs of published specific primers, 6261 and 6779, ev22(+) and ev22(-), F1 and R1, 188F and 542R, was used to amplify the viral genomes and specifically generate four different amplicon sizes of 519, 270, 440, and 354 bp for Aichi virus, human parechovirus, enteroviruses, and human bocavirus, respectively. A total of 247 fecal specimens previously screened for rotavirus, adenovirus, norovirus, sapovirus, and astrovirus-negative, collected from infants and children with acute gastroenteritis in Japan from July 2007 to June 2008, were tested further for the presence of the four viruses, Aichi virus, human parechovirus, enteroviruses, and human bocavirus, by RT-multiplex PCR. The total detection rate of these viruses was 26.7% (66 out of 247 samples). Of these, HPeV, EVs, and HBoV were identified in 20, 41, and 5 specimens. No Aichi virus was found among these subjects. The sensitivity and specificity of RT-multiplex PCR were assessed and demonstrated a strong validation against RT-monoplex PCR. This is the first report of detecting these types of viruses in fecal samples from infants and children with acute gastroenteritis by RT-multiplex PCR.

Abstract
BACKGROUND Germline mutations in several members of RAS/RAF/MEK/ERK pathway cause clinically similar genetic disorders, including Noonan syndrome (NS), Costello syndrome (CS) and cardio-facio-cutaneous syndrome (CFC). Each of these syndromes has a wide spectrum of molecular etiology. The aim of the present study was to conduct a comprehensive genetic analysis of RAS/RAF/MEK/ERK pathway in these syndromes. METHODS Three patients with NS and two patients with CS/CFC were examined. Peripheral blood samples were collected from all patients as well as from 100 healthy Japanese volunteers. The protein phosphatase, non-receptor type II (PTPN11), KRAS, HRAS, NRAS, BRAF, RAF1, Son of Sevenless (SOS1) and MEK1genes were analyzed. RESULTS In a patient with a severe Noonan phenotype, a rare PTPN11 mutation was detected: A to G transition at position 172, causing an N58D substitution within the N-SH2 domain. In a CS/CFC patient no HRAS mutations were found, but a novel SOS1 missense mutation was found: A to G transition at position 473, causing a T158A substitution within domain of histone-like fold (HF). CONCLUSIONS A case mimicking CS with SOS1 T158A substitution, which has not been reported previously in CS, revealed the complex relationship between the genotype and phenotype of overlapping syndromes of the RAS/RAF/MEK/ERK pathway.

Abstract
Breast milk contains immunological factors, such as IgA antibody, which help to prevent infectious diseases. A total of 197 paired samples of colostrum and breast milk was collected from postpartum mothers in Gunma City, Japan, and examined for anti-rubella IgA antibody by enzyme-linked immunosorbent assay (ELISA) and Western blotting (WB). The anti-rubella virus IgA ranged from 0.5 to 78.5 U/ml with a mean of 6.05 U/ml and a median of 3.6 U/ml in colostrum, and from 0.5 to 32.7 U/ml with a mean of 2.74 U/ml and a median of 2 U/ml in milk. The differences between the means of titers of total IgA and anti-rubella virus IgA in colostrum and in milk were significant statistically. The levels of anti-rubella virus IgA in both colostrum and breast milk correlated positively with the anti-rubella virus hemagglutination inhibition (HI) titers in the sera of mother, indicating that the levels of these different classes of antibodies correlated. Based on WB, anti-rubella virus IgA in both colostrum and breast milk reacted with the rubella viral protein E1 and C, but not with the E2 protein.

Abstract
Sequence and phylogenetic analyses of the rotavirus VP7 gene were performed on 52 human G2 and G4 strains isolated in Japan, China, Thailand, and Vietnam during 2001-2003. All genotype G2 strains included in the study clustered into lineage II of the phylogenetic tree, together with the majority of global G2 strains detected since 1995. The amino acid substitution at position 96 from aspartic acid to asparagine was noted among the emerging or re-emerging G2 rotavirus strains in Japan, Thailand, and Vietnam during 2002-2003. Genotype G4 strains detected in Vietnam grouped into lineage Ia of the phylogenetic tree, whereas Japanese G4 strains clustered in lineage Ic which included emerging G4 strains from Argentina, Italy, Paraguay, and Uruguay. It is noteworthy that an insertion of asparagine was found at position 76 in all the Japanese strains and that its presence might be involved in the emergence of G4 rotavirus in Japan during 2002-2003.

Abstract
In Japan, from July 2010, an infant or a child with brain death will be legally regarded as a candidate of donor for organ transplantation under the consent of his or her family members. Official diagnostic criteria of brain death in children are currently under compilation. The causes and incidence of brain death remarkably differ among individuals belonging to different age groups. Secondary brain damages resulting from asphyxia, drowning, hypoxemia, and cardiopulmonary arrest more commonly occur in childhood than in adulthood. Child abuse or neglect is suspected to be involved in many of the cases of brain death. The current Japanese diagnostic criteria hitherto used for adults require several modifications before these can be applied to infants and children. According to the requirements of the new act, abused or neglected infants and children must be excluded from the category of donor candidates. Neonates and young infants below 12 weeks of corrected age will also be excluded, because neurological diagnosis of brain death is difficult in these individuals.

Abstract
VP6 protein antigens allow classification of rotaviruses into at least four subgroups, depending on the presence or absence of SG-specific epitopes: SG I, SG II, SG (I+II), and SG non-(I+II). However, MAbs against epitopes on the VP6 protein of human and porcine rotaviruses, sometimes, do not recognize SG-specific epitopes or recognize irrelevant-SG epitopes and therefore result in the incorrect assignment of subgroups. In order to solve this problem, a novel multiplex RT-PCR was developed as an alternative tool to identify VP6 genogroups using newly designed primers which are specific for genogroup I or II. The sensitivity and specificity of the newly developed multiplex RT-PCR method was evaluated by testing with human and porcine rotaviruses of known SG I, SG II, SG (I+II), and SG non-(I+II) strains in comparison with monoplex RT-PCR and VP6 sequence analysis. The results show that the genogroups of both human and porcine rotaviruses as determined by the new multiplex RT-PCR method were in 100% agreement with those determined by monoplex RT-PCR and VP6 sequence analysis. The method was shown to be specific, sensitive, less-time consuming, and successful in genogrouping clinical isolates of rotaviruses circulating in children and piglets with acute diarrhea.

Abstract
Holoprosencephaly (HPE) is the most common congenital malformation of the developing human forebrain, in which the two cerebral hemispheres fail to separate to various degrees. Although pathological mutations have been identified in up to nine genes, a number of other genes as well as environmental factors are likely to be involved in HPE. Here, we describe a case with the middle interhemispheric variant, a milder variant of HPE, carrying a deletion of approximately 10.4 Mb at 6q22.31-q23.2, which includes the EYA4 gene. EYA4 is one of four vertebrate orthologs of the Drosophila melanogaster gene, eyes absent. EYA4 was co-immunoprecipitated with SIX3, the product of one of the known HPE genes. Moreover, the EYA4 protein was observed to be recruited to the nucleus by the nuclear protein SIX3 under a confocal microscope. EYA4 is a transcriptional coactivator, and was shown to cooperate with transcription factor SIX3 by reporter gene assays. These results demonstrate physical and functional association between EYA4 and SIX3, suggesting that EYA4 is a novel candidate gene of HPE, whose haploinsufficiency leads to HPE through the compromised function of SIX3.

Abstract
PROBLEM Epidemiological data suggested that pandemic influenza increased the risks of spontaneous abortion and premature labor, while seasonal influenza also increased the risk of schizophrenia in adolescence. However, their pathogenesis is so far unknown. METHOD OF STUDY The first trimester trophoblast cell lines, namely, Swan71 and HTR8 cells were challenged with A/Udorn/72 influenza virus (H3N2). At indicated time points, cells were examined for expression of influenza proteins. Viral replication in culture media, apoptosis and the expression of human leukocyte antigen (HLA)-G were also examined. RESULTS Intracellular localization of viral proteins was observed. Twenty-four hours after inoculation, virus was detected in culture media while most cells fell into apoptosis. During apoptosis, expression of HLA-G was unchanged. CONCLUSION We revealed replication of low pathogenic influenza virus in the first trimester trophoblast cell lines. Placental damages are likely to be induced by direct cytopathic effects of influenza virus and subsequent apoptosis rather than down regulation of HLA-G expression and subsequent rejection by maternal immune system.

Abstract
In acute encephalopathy with febrile convulsive status epilepticus (AEFCSE), subcortical white matter lesions on diffusion-weighted images are sometimes encountered on magnetic resonance imaging (MRI), such as in acute encephalopathy with biphasic seizures and late reduced diffusion (AESD). We report here a severe case of AEFCSE following respiratory syncytial virus infection, with emphasis on the cranial MRI findings. MRI in this patient showed widespread T2-hyperintensity along the cerebral cortical gray matter from day 3 to day 22. Lesions with reduced diffusion were noted on day 3 in the deep zone of gray matter of the left occipito-temporo-parietal cortex, but on day 7 they shifted to the subcortical white matter of both the cerebral hemispheres. These MRI findings provide radiologic evidence for damage to the cortical gray matter in AEFCSE. The serial change of diffusion-weighted images suggests that the cortical gray matter may be injured prior to the involvement of the subcortical white matter.

Abstract
OBJECTIVE To clarify the features of delirious behavior in patients with acute necrotizing encephalopathy. METHODS We retrospectively evaluated the clinical course of 38 children with acute necrotizing encephalopathy diagnosed on the basis of neuroradiological findings. The patients were divided into two groups according to the presence or absence of delirious behavior. We compared clinical features, laboratory data, neuroimaging findings, and outcome between those with and without delirious behavior. In patients with delirious behavior, chronological sequence of neurological symptoms and the characteristics of delirious behavior were investigated. RESULTS Delirious behavior was observed in 8 patients. Patient characteristics or most laboratory data on admission were not significantly different between those with and without delirious behavior. Brainstem lesions were more frequent in patients with delirious behavior than in those without. In contrast, lesions in lentiform nuclei, cerebral hemisphere, or cerebellum were relatively more frequent in patients without delirious behavior. It was the initial neurological symptom in 7 of 8 patients. Stupor and seizures were observed after delirious behavior in most patients. CONCLUSIONS Delirious behavior was not uncommon in children with acute necrotizing encephalopathy. Brainstem lesions may be related to the development of delirious behavior of children with acute necrotizing encephalopathy.

Abstract
OBJECTIVE To study whether dysregulation of insulin-like growth factors (IGFs) and IGF signaling are common molecular changes in symptomatic leiomyomas (fibroids) and whether IGFs are associated with large fibroids. DESIGN Examination of IGFs and IGF pathway genes in a large cohort of fibroids at transcriptional and translational levels. Mechanisms leading to alterations of IGFs and related genes were also analyzed. SETTING University clinical research laboratory. PATIENT(S) Hysterectomies for symptomatic fibroids were collected: 180 cases from paraffin-embedded tissues and 50 cases from fresh-frozen tissues. INTERVENTION(S) Tissue microarray and immunohistochemistry, DNA methylation analysis, reverse-transcriptase polymerase chain reaction, and Western blot. MAIN OUTCOME MEASUREMENT(S) Transcription and translation analyses of IGF-1/2, p-AKT, p-S6K, and TSC1/2 in fibroids and matched myometrium. RESULT(S) Insulin-like growth factors and downstream effectors were dysregulated in approximately one third of fibroids. All except for IGF-2 seemed to be abnormally regulated at translation levels. Up-regulation of IGF-2 messenger RNAs was contributed by all four alternating slicing promoters. There was a positive correlation of IGF-1 and p-AKT over-expression with fibroid size. Insulin-like growth factor 1 but not IGF-2 levels directly correlated with activation of p-AKT and p-S6K. CONCLUSION(S) Altered expressions of IGFs and their related downstream proteins were found in one third of fibroids. Large fibroids show high levels of IGF-1 and p-AKT activity compared with small ones.

Abstract
Monkeypox virus (MPXV) causes a smallpox-like disease in non-human primates and humans. This infection is endemic to central and western Africa. MPXV is divided into two genetically different groups, Congo Basin and West African MPXV, with the former being the more virulent. A real-time quantitative MPXV genome amplification system was developed for the diagnosis of MPXV infections using loop-mediated isothermal amplification (LAMP) technology. Primers used for genome amplification of Congo Basin (C-LAMP), West African (W-LAMP), and both Congo Basin and West African (COM-LAMP) MPXV by LAMP were designed according to the nucleotide sequences of the Congo Basin-specific D14L gene, the West African-specific partial ATI gene, and the partial ATI gene that is shared by both groups, respectively. The sensitivity and specificity of the LAMP were evaluated with nested PCR using peripheral blood and throat swab specimens collected from Congo Basin MPXV or West African MPXV-infected monkeys. The sensitivity and specificity of COM-LAMP, C-LAMP, and W-LAMP were 80% (45/56) and 100% (64/64); 79% (19/24) and 100% (24/24); and 72% (23/32) and 100% (40/40), respectively. The viremia level determined by LAMP assays increased with increases in the severity of the monkeypox-associated symptoms. The newly developed LAMP assay was confirmed to be a rapid, quantifiable, and highly sensitive and specific system effective in the diagnosis of MPXV infections. The LAMP assays made it possible to discriminate between Congo Basin and West African MPXV. The LAMP developed in this study is useful not only for diagnosis of but also for the assessment of MPXV infections.

Abstract
In the field of spintronics, researchers have manipulated magnetization using spin-polarized currents. Another option is to use a voltage-induced symmetry change in a ferromagnetic material to cause changes in magnetization or in magnetic anisotropy. However, a significant improvement in efficiency is needed before this approach can be used in memory devices with ultralow power consumption. Here, we show that a relatively small electric field (less than 100 mV nm(-1)) can cause a large change (approximately 40%) in the magnetic anisotropy of a bcc Fe(001)/MgO(001) junction. The effect is tentatively attributed to the change in the relative occupation of 3d orbitals of Fe atoms adjacent to the MgO barrier. Simulations confirm that voltage-controlled magnetization switching in magnetic tunnel junctions is possible using the anisotropy change demonstrated here, which could be of use in the development of low-power logic devices and non-volatile memory cells.

Abstract
The aim of this study was to clarify the difference between influenza and non-influenza cases in clinical symptoms, laboratory and neuroimaging findings, and outcome in children with ANE. We retrospectively studied 22 children with ANE. Eleven of them had virological proof of influenza infection and the other 11 were judged as non-influenza infection. There was no significant difference between influenza and non-influenza cases in sex, antipyretics use and neurological symptoms. Although laboratory data were not different between the two groups, brainstem lesions were relatively more frequent in influenza cases than in non-influenza cases. Outcome was not different between the two groups. The results of our study suggest that the pathogenesis of acute necrotizing encephalopathy will not be dependent on infectious agents.

Abstract
BACKGROUND Norovirus (NoV) infection is thought to be confined to the intestines, whereas many reports suggest antigenemia and viremia occur during rotavirus gastroenteritis. OBJECTIVES To detect NoV RNA in sera and cerebrospinal fluids (CSF) from NoV-infected children, and to quantify and genetically characterize the NoV found in these compartments. STUDY DESIGN Semi-nested PCR was conducted on stool, serum and CSF samples from 56 patients with acute gastroenteritis. Positive samples for NoV were analyzed further by sequencing and real-time PCR. RESULTS From 39 patients with NoV RNA in stools, 6 also had NoV RNA in sera and none had NoV RNA in CSF. Genotypes of the NoV in stool and serum from the same patient matched completely. The strains in this study had high homology (98.1-100%) with registered strains in the database. The median viral load in stools of the serum-positive patients was greater than that of the serum-negative patients, but this difference was not statistically significant (9.8 x 10(9)copies/g versus 1.1 x 10(9)copies/g (p=0.117)). CONCLUSIONS NoV RNA appeared in the blood stream in 15% of the patients of NoV gastroenteritis. Although the viral load in stool was not statistically correlated with NoV appearance in serum, genetic analysis indicated that NoV RNA in sera originated from the NoV gastroenteritis.
